Transaction 41d1e81123771fcd3321cdb55fac316bcf177bae7b4562d4a9d9e3a1d69b5706

2 Input
1 Outputs
  • 41d1e81123771fcd3321cdb55fac316bcf177bae7b4562d4a9d9e3a1d69b5706:0
  • value  1283399
    address  32dtBHKk24z4G36CK5tjCy7dhGkghQAsZd